Find your superpower with the Graduate Development Program

National Grid’s Graduate Development Program (GDP) is a year-long development program for recent college graduates who aspire to take on future leadership roles in a dynamic, ever-changing industry. Graduates will shape the future of National Grid. Bringing fresh thinking, new perspectives, and exploring with energy, we’ll give you real responsibility and an opportunity to move with purpose from day one – putting the power to supercharge your career in your hands.

 

Graduates start their careers at National Grid with an in-depth 3-week in-person Orientation which gives you exposure to all parts of the company, allows you to network with your Graduate cohort, GDP alumni, and senior leaders, and provides you with the opportunity to travel throughout our service territory in the northeast US. Following Orientation, you’ll begin working in full-time position outlined below and take part in ongoing development activities including quarterly development sessions, active mentorship, and a Hackathon Project.

About the Position

As an Associate Engineer, you will be part of a team that is responsible for creating recommendations for any required modifications and additions to our sub-transmission and distribution facilities. These recommendations help to enhance the resiliency of the system to adverse weather events and to modernize the grid to meet forecasted capacity requirements and expanding customer service quality expectations.

 

This is a hybrid role with limited travel.

 

What You’ll Do

  • Provide immediate and long-term system planning and asset management direction in an interdependent and synergistic practice.
  • Assist regional customer operations in the technical operation of the distribution system.
  • Conduct customer and distributed generation studies and interconnection compliance verification engineering activities.
  • Provide technical expertise and support from an engineering perspective to ensure integration of distributed generation to the electric power system in compliance with the NYSIR and National Grid’s energization requirements.
  • Represent the company on industry and regulatory working groups as appropriate.
